Rare earths are silvery-grey metals. There are 17 of them, ranging from lanthanum (atomic number 57) to lutetium (atomic number 73), and most of them are in their own row in the periodic table because of their unusual atomic structure.

By the way, President Trump, the periodic table is not to be confused with ladies’ monthly cycles (“blood coming out of her wherever”).

Their arrangement of electrons can give them remarkable properties such as luminescence—used for the screens of smartphones—and magnetism. They are often added to other metals in small amounts to enhance their performance; magnets with rare earths can be 15 times as powerful as those without them.

Despite their name, rare earth elements (REE) aren’t particularly rare—they’re just difficult to extract. This group of 17 elements can be found on earth’s crust in many place around the world.

The rare earth industry happens to be one that China dominates –

  • Reserve advantage: China holds the biggest share of global REE reserve at 37%, roughly 44 million tons
  • Mining dominance: China accounted for 168,000 tons out of 240,000 global production, representing 70% of total REE mining
  • Processing and refining monopoly: China dominates roughly 90% global REE processing, turning raw ores into usable oxides, metals and magnets. For heavy rare earth such as terbium, ytterbium and yttrium, China’s dominance is absolute at 100%. Heavy REEs (HREEs) are especially important in high tech and military applications (e.g. jet engine coating).
  • Production concentration: 6 state owned companies control 90% of the REE industry in China such as China Norther Rare Earth and Shenghe Resources. Refining facilities are concentrated in 2 provinces – Inner Mongolia and Jiangxi in southern China.
  • Dominance in every part of the supply chain: China’s rare earth strength extends from mines, extraction, separation, to processing and production of final product such as magnets. China owns proprietary mining, separation and processing technologies and develops most of the specialized chemicals, machinery, tooling, and equipment. China has by far the largest pool of REE scientists, engineers, and technicians in the world
  • Control over global supply chain: as mentioned, rare earth elements are found in many places, including Vietnam, Australia, Myanmar, and the US. But even non-Chinese mines send ores to China for processing for technical know-how and processing facilities. For example, the Mountain Pass mine in California used to send most of its ores to China for processing before the tariff war
  • Cost and quality competitiveness: due to the large scale of REE production and processing in China as well as its control over key technologies, Chinese producers are the most competitive in cost and quality. Chinese producers dictate REE price in the global market (which actually is quite small, compared with more commonly used minerals such as lithium, nickel, or copper, given the niche nature of the product)

The US military relies on Chinese REE to produce much of its arsenal

According to a recent CSIS report, REEs are crucial for a range of defence technologies, including F-35 fighter jets, Virginia- and Columbia-class submarines, Tomahawk missiles, radar systems, Predator unmanned aerial vehicles, and the Joint Direct Attack Munition series of smart bombs.

For example, the F-35 fighter jet contains over 900 pounds of REEs. An Arleigh Burke-class DDG-51 destroyer requires approximately 5,200 pounds, while a Virginia-class submarine uses around 9,200 pounds.

CSIS report gave examples such as how US fighter jets depend on China-sourced REE in the form of magnets and stealth coating, engine coating. For example, yttrium is required for high temperature jet engine coatings; such thermal barrier coatings on turbine blades stop aircraft engines from melting mid-flight.

Back in 2022, the Pentagon temporarily suspended deliveries of F-35 jets after Lockheed acknowledged an alloy made in China was in a component of the jet, violating federal defence acquisition rules. But it had to exempt Lockheed and resume delivery because no replacement could be found. Pentagon ended up violating US laws in order to build weapons to fight China with parts sourced from China.

CSIS pointed out this is akin to buy bullets from your enemy to fight the same enemy.

This reminds me of an episode in Walter Isaacson’s biography on Steve Jobs and his view on making iPhone in the US.

Back in 2011 President Obama had dinner with a bunch of Silicon Valley bosses in California. Over dinner he asked Jobs, “What would it take to make iPhones in the United States?”

The famously blunt Apple boss didn’t mince words. “Those jobs aren’t coming back,” he replied.

The reason wasn’t just lower costs in China. The New York Time reported, “Apple’s executives believe the vast scale of Chinese factories as well as the flexibility, diligence and industrial skills of the workers have so outpaced their American counterparts that ‘Made in the U.S.A.’ is no longer a viable option for most Apple products.”

To illustrate, NYT offered a story shared by a former Apple executive about a last-minute design change to the iPhone’s screen that forced a change in the manufacturing process at the Chinese factory where the phones were being made.

Around midnight, 8,000 workers were assembled and within half an hour started a 12-hour shift fitting glass screens into bevelled frames. Within 96 hours, the plant was producing more than 10,000 iPhones a day with the latest design change.

“The speed and flexibility is breathtaking,” the executive told NYT. “There’s no American plant that can match that.”

Tim Cook, the supply chain boss at Apple before becoming the CEO, said this about tooling engineers – “in America, you can barely fill a room with tooling engineers. In China, you can fill several football fields”.

As is well known, the US has been deindustrializing since 1950s as its manufacturing job peaked in late 40s (37% of total employment) and the economy started to move towards a consumption and service based economy.

By 1971, less than 25% of US employment was in manufacturing. By 2000, it fell to 13% and today manufacturing employment hovers around 9% (more or less so for a decade).

Although NAFTA (1994) and China’s entry into WTO (2001) are regularly invoked as key events driving deindustrialization, the US manufacturing employment and GDP contribution has been on a smooth downward trend since 1945. By the time China ramped up manufacturing in mid 2000s, deindustrialization was completed and the US was already a service-based economy. In early April, Chinese scientists achieved a milestone in clean energy technology by successfully adding fresh fuel to an operational thorium molten salt reactor, the first of its kind in the world. The breakthrough signals the arrival of commercially viable thorium nuclear reactor in China’s future energy mix.

Thorium is much safer and more abundant alternative to uranium for nuclear power as it is widely available, cheaper to extract, has higher energy density, and produces far less long-lasting nuclear waste.

It is far safer than uranium as it is not fissile on its own so cannot be weaponized. Nuclear industry experts see thorium as the holy grail for future energy revolution next to nuclear fusion, which I’ll touch on briefly at the end.

Thorium is found in abundant quantity in earth’s crust all over the world. One single mine in China’s Inner Mongolia, the Bayan Obo mine, has enough thorium deposits to theoretically meet China’s energy needs for the next 20,000 years, while producing minimal radioactive waste.

The most promising technological direction is to use thorium in molten salt reactors. While multiple nations are developing the technology, China is the first to build an experimental thorium molten salt reactor.

The latest breakthrough to add fresh fuel to an operational reactor indicates such technology is ready for sustained commercial deployment.

It marks the first long-term, stable operation of the technology, putting China at the forefront of a global race to harness thorium for nuclear power.

The experimental reactor, located in the Gobi Desert in China’s west, uses molten salt as the fuel carrier and coolant, and thorium as the fuel source. The reactor is designed to sustainably generate 2 megawatts of thermal power.

The development was announced by the project’s chief scientist, Xu Hongjie, at the Chinese Academy of Sciences on April 8. Xu said China “now leads the global frontier for thorium nuclear technology”.

China’s thorium molten salt reactor project began with theoretical research in the 1970s, and in 2009 the CAS leadership tasked Xu with making the next-generation nuclear energy technology a reality.

The project team expanded from dozens of members to more than 400 researchers within two years.

“We learned by doing, and did by learning,” Xu said. The challenges were immense – designing new materials, troubleshooting for extreme temperatures, and dealing with engineering components that had never been built before.

After construction of the experimental reactor started in 2018, most of the scientists involved in the project gave up their holidays – they worked day and night, and some stayed on site for more than 300 days in a year. The Gobi Desert is thousands of kilometres away from the major coastal cities.

By October 2023 it was built and achieved criticality – a sustained nuclear chain reaction. And by June 2024 it had reached full-power operation.

Earlier this year the process of thorium fuel reloading was completed while the reactor was running – making it the only operational thorium reactor in the world.

“We chose the hardest path, but the right one,” Xu was quoted as saying, referring to the drive for a real-world application rather than a purely academic pursuit.

A much bigger thorium molten salt reactor is already being built in China and is slated to achieve criticality by 2030. That research reactor is designed to produce 10 megawatts of electricity, enough to power 10,000 homes for a year.

In addition to thorium reactors, China is on the leading edge of developing nuclear fusion technology (as opposed to current fission technology) that could lead to carbon-free, almost limitless, and clean energy. Fusion is the way sun powers itself and generates 4 times the amount of energy as fission.

At the heart of this fusion revolution lies the tokamak, a donut-shaped device designed to contain superheated plasma using powerful magnetic fields. By mimicking the sun’s conditions—where hydrogen atoms fuse into helium—tokamaks enable the release of tremendous amounts of energy.

China is at the leading edge in global nuclear fusion development. Most recently, China achieved several key milestones in fusion research, including –

– Experimental Advanced Superconducting Tokamak (EAST), dubbed as “artificial sun” in China, has set new record in January 2025. The project is based Hefei and run by the China Academy of Sciences (CAS), the world’s leading scientific research institute.

EAST maintained a high-confinement plasma for 1,066 seconds, surpassing previous world record of 403 seconds – a crucial step towards sustained fusion reactions necessary for practical energy generation.

– HL-2M Tokamak, located in Chengdu, is China’s largest and most advanced tokamak. It has achieved first plasma discharge and high plasma parameters, capable of producing plasma temperatures exceeding 200 million degrees Celsius and plasma currents over 2.5 million amperes, essential for efficient fusion reactions.

– HH70 Tokamak, developed by Shanghai-based private company Energy Singularity, stands out for integrating high temperature superconducting magnets made from REBCO (rare earth barium copper oxide). This cutting edge technology dramatically reduces the size and cost of conventional tokamaks, paving the way for more accessible and commercial fusion energy.

Energy Singularity plans to construct a next-gen tokamak by 2027 and a full scale technological demonstrator for fusion nuclear reaction by 2030.

Although commercial viability remains the final frontier, breakthroughs like EAST and HH70 showcase the significant strides towards turning nuclear fusion into a practical energy solution.
